Job Position Competition at Transport Ministry 2026: deadlines and requirements for civil servants

If you are a career civil servant of the AGE provisionally assigned or in expectation of posting, this competition is not optional for you: you have the obligation to participate if any of the called positions corresponds to your situation. The Resolution of September 3, 2026, published in the BOE on September 17, 2026, activates the provision process with immediate effect.

The deadline is short and the channel is exclusively electronic. Knowing the requirements and exceptions from day one makes the difference between participating correctly or being left out of the process.

What does this regulation establish?

The resolution calls a specific competition to provide vacant positions with budgetary allocation in the Ministry of Transport and Sustainable Mobility. The key aspects of the procedure are as follows:

AspectDetail
Type of competitionSpecific competition for provision of vacant positions with budgetary allocation
Who can participateCareer civil servants in any administrative situation, except current firm suspension
Permanence requirementMinimum 2 years in the current definitive posting at the time of submitting the application
Exceptions to permanencePosition suppression, leaves of absence or special services
Application deadline15 business days from publication (from 17/09/2026)
Submission channelElectronically through the Funciona Portal with electronic certificate
Obligation to participateCivil servants in provisional assignment or in expectation of posting, if their position is called
Equality principleThe AGE IV Equality Plan is applied

The specific competition is the ordinary modality of position provision in the AGE for career civil servants. Unlike free appointment, the specific competition weighs objective merits and specific position requirements, which provides greater legal certainty to the process.

Economic and operational impact

For affected civil servants, the operational impact is immediate: the 15 business days deadline begins on the same day of publication. This means that the window of action is narrow and does not allow for delays.

From the perspective of human resources management in the Ministry, the call allows filling vacancies with budgetary allocation already assigned, which does not generate additional cost to the approved budget. Provision by specific competition ensures that positions are filled by civil servants who meet the required profile.

For civil servants in provisional assignment, participation is not an option: it is a legal obligation if the called position corresponds to their situation. Not participating when this obligation exists can have administrative consequences for their provisional status.

Compliance with the AGE IV Equality Plan in this process means that the evaluation criteria and competition management must respect the gender equality principles established in that plan, which affects how merits are designed and evaluated.

Who does it affect?

  • Career civil servants of the AGE in active service status who wish to change posting and meet the minimum 2-year permanence requirement.
  • Civil servants in provisional assignment whose position appears in the call: they have obligation to participate.
  • Civil servants in expectation of posting whose position appears in the call: they have obligation to participate.
  • Civil servants on leave of absence or special services who wish to return: they are exempt from the minimum 2-year permanence requirement.
  • Civil servants whose position has been suppressed: they are also exempt from the permanence requirement.
  • Civil servants with current firm suspension: excluded from participating in the competition.

Practical example

A career civil servant of the General Administrative Corps provisionally assigned to a position in the Under-Secretariat for Transport receives notification that that position appears in the call. In this case, they cannot choose not to participate: the resolution imposes the obligation to submit an application.

They have 15 business days from September 17, 2026 to access the Funciona Portal, identify themselves with their electronic certificate and complete the participation application. If they do not do so within the deadline, their provisional assignment status may be administratively affected.

On the other hand, a civil servant in active service with definitive posting for 18 months who wishes to compete for one of the called positions will not be able to participate: they do not meet the minimum 2-year permanence requirement in their current posting, and are not in any of the excepted situations (position suppression, leave of absence or special services).

What should civil servants do now?

  1. Verify if the position is called: Consult the annex of positions in the resolution published in the BOE of September 17, 2026 to check if your position appears in the call.
  2. Check administrative status: Determine if you are in provisional assignment, expectation of posting, leave of absence, special services or active service with definitive posting, as each situation has different rules.
  3. Verify compliance with permanence requirement: Confirm that you have been in your current definitive posting for at least 2 years, unless you are in one of the excepted situations.
  4. Prepare electronic certificate: Ensure that your electronic certificate is current and operational to be able to access the Funciona Portal and submit the application.
  5. Submit application on time: Access the Funciona Portal and complete the application within the 15 business days from September 17, 2026. No other submission channel is accepted.
  6. Keep submission receipt: Save the electronic acknowledgment of receipt as proof of timely submission.

Frequently asked questions

What is the deadline to apply to participate in the Transport Ministry job competition 2026?

The deadline is 15 business days counted from the publication of the resolution, which took place on September 17, 2026. Applications must be submitted exclusively electronically through the Funciona Portal with electronic certificate.

Which civil servants have obligation to participate in this specific competition?

Civil servants who are in provisional assignment or in expectation of posting have obligation to participate, provided that any of the called positions corresponds to their situation. For other civil servants, participation is voluntary, subject to meeting the requirements.

What if I have been in my current posting for less than 2 years? Can I participate?

Generally, no. The resolution requires a minimum permanence of 2 years in the current definitive posting at the time of submitting the application. However, civil servants whose position has been suppressed, those in leave of absence and those in special services are exempt from this requirement.

How do I submit the application for the Transport Ministry job competition?

Submission is exclusively electronic through the Funciona Portal, using electronic certificate. No other submission channel is accepted. It is essential to have your electronic certificate current and operational before the 15 business days deadline expires.

Can civil servants with firm suspension participate?

No. The resolution expressly excludes from participation civil servants who have current firm suspension at the time of submitting the application. The rest of administrative situations (active service, leave of absence, special services, provisional assignment, expectation of posting) do allow participation, with the specific conditions of each one.
